How Fast Is An Avalanche?
Avalanches can travel downhill at about 150 mph.

How to survive an avalanche
If you are skiing, while skiing downhill, ski left or right to get out of the way.
Grab for a tree.
No tree? Swim!
Getting away in a snowmobile will work too.
You can suffocate if you get caught in an avalanche, which can happen if you are in for longer than 15 min.
